We are seeking a Paraprofessional II / 504 Support team member at William Henry Harrison High School.
Job Summary: The Paraprofessional II / 504 Support is responsible for providing support to students with 504 Plans to ensure equitable access to the educational environment. Working under the direction of teachers, counselors, and administrators, this position assists with the implementation of 504 accommodations, promotes student independence, and supports student success in the general education setting.

Southwest Local School District participates in the Southwest Ohio Organization for School Health (SWOOSH). SWOOSH is a health and wellness consortium for school districts and government agencies that come together to provide stability and quality access to health care and benefits to all eligible members.
